What ASTM A416 Covers

It sets the mechanical and dimensional requirements for seven-wire prestressing strand, including breaking strength, yield, and elongation acceptance criteria.

How the Test Is Run

A strand sample is gripped with strand-specific grips and pulled to failure, and breaking force, yield strength, and elongation are checked against the specification.

Why It Matters

Strand acceptance testing underpins prestressed-concrete safety; strand grips or sockets and high-force capacity are essential.

Related Standards

ASTM A1061 provides the strand test methods and BS 5896 is the British prestressing wire and strand specification.
